WW2 USA United States 8th Infantry Division Cloth  Shoulder Patch

WW2 USA United States 8th Infantry Division Cloth Shoulder Patch

The division was known as the "Golden Arrow" division or the "Pathfinder" division. It features a blue shield with a white number "8" superimposed on a vertical golden arrow. The 8th Infantry Division was active during World War II, landing on Utah Beach in Normandy on July 4, 1944.

A good WW2-era patch. In very good condition. It does not 'glow' under UV light.

WW2 Essex & Suffolk / East Anglian District (Eastern Command) Printed Formation Sign Patch Flash Designation Badge

WW2 Essex & Suffolk / East Anglian District (Eastern Command) Printed Formation Sign Patch Flash Designation Badge

Unissued condition, a 2nd pattern black and yellow printed cloth formation sign. On the re-organisation of Eastern Command in 1944, this badge was adopted from the old Essex and Suffolk District badge. Minor edge fraying otherwise in very good condition.
